NCT ID: NCT04003610 Terminated - Clinical trials for Metastatic Urothelial Carcinoma

Pemigatinib + Pembrolizumab vs Pemigatinib Alone vs Standard of Care for Urothelial Carcinoma (FIGHT-205)

Start date: May 14, 2020
Phase: Phase 2
Study type: Interventional

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of pemigatinib plus pembrolizumab or pemigatinib alone versus the standard of care for participants with metastatic or unresectable urothelial carcinoma who are not eligible to receive cisplatin, are harboring FGFR3 mutation or rearrangement, and who have not received prior treatment.

NCT ID: NCT03948178 Terminated - Clinical trials for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is

Effects of Oral Levosimendan on Respiratory Function in Patients With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S): Open-Label Extension

REFALS-ES
Start date: June 26, 2019
Phase: Phase 3
Study type: Interventional

This study provides an opportunity for subjects in the REFALS (3119002; NCT03505021) study to continue treatment with oral levosimendan. The study will also provide more information about long-term safety and effectiveness of oral levosimendan in patients with ALS. This is an open-label study, so that all eligible subjects that complete the double-blind REFALS study (48-weeks of treatment) will have the opportunity to receive oral levosimendan treatment. The primary objective, in addition to continuing treatment for subjects enrolled in the REFALS study, is to evaluate long-term safety of oral levosimendan in ALS patients. Another important objective is to explore long-term effectiveness of oral levosimendan in the treatment of patients with ALS. This study is open only to patients taking part in the REFALS study.

NCT ID: NCT03943446 Terminated - Crohn Disease Clinical Trials

A Study of TAK-018 in Preventing the Recurrence of Crohn's Disease After Surgery

Start date: August 4, 2020
Phase: Phase 2
Study type: Interventional

The main aim is to see if TAK-018 reduces the recurrence of intestinal inflammation after abdominal resection surgery in adults with Crohn's disease. Participants will take either TAK-018 or placebo tablets by mouth, 2 times each day for up to 26 weeks after surgery. The placebo looks like TAK-018 but will not have any medicine in it. Participants will have 6 study visits while receiving treatment. Visits 1 and 6 will be conducted at the study clinic. The others can be in the clinic or at the participant's home. Follow-up will occur 4 weeks after final treatment.

NCT ID: NCT03834220 Terminated - Solid Tumor Clinical Trials

Basket Trial in Solid Tumors Harboring a Fusion of FGFR1, FGFR2 or FGFR3- (FUZE Clinical Trial)

Start date: March 22, 2019
Phase: Phase 2
Study type: Interventional

The primary objective of this study is to assess the efficacy of Debio 1347 in terms of objective response rate (ORR) in participants with solid tumors harboring fibroblast growth factor receptor (FGFR)1-3 gene fusion/rearrangement.
